The laser-induced fluorescence spectroscopy of gold monoxide: B-2 sigma(-)-X-2 pi(3/2) transition

英文摘要The electronic spectrum of the gaseous gold monoxide molecule has been investigated in the range of 16000-18500 cm(-1) using laser induced fluorescence spectroscopy and single vibronic level emission spectra. Five rotationally resolved vibronic bands are observed and assigned to the transitions B-2 sigma(-) (v' = 0-4) -X-3/2(2) (v'' = 0), in which the 0-0 transition is observed for the first time. The molecular constants of the excited state B-2 sigma(-) are obtained by a rotational analysis of the spectra. The spin-orbit coupling constant and the vibrational constants of the ground state X-i(2) are determined with the accuracy improved by one order of magnitude. The lifetimes of most observed bands are also measured for the first time.
